    Upside-Down Apple Gingerbread


    Source of Recipe


    Adapted from: Taste of Home Make-a-Meal Recipe Book

    List of Ingredients




    3/4 cup light butter, melted & divided
    2 large apples, peeled, cored & sliced (or pears, about 3-4)
    2/3 cup packed brown sugar, divided
    1/2 cup molasses
    1/2 cup sugar
    1 egg
    2 cups flour
    1 tsp baking soda
    1 tsp cinnamon
    1 tsp ginger
    1/2 tsp cloves
    1/4 tsp freshly grated nutmeg
    1/2 tsp kosher salt
    3/4 cup hot brewed tea (orange pekoe is good)

    Recipe



    Preheat oven to 350°F. Pour 1/4 cup melted butter into a 9" baking pan. (she used a cast iron skillet) Arrange apple slices over butter. Sprinkle with 1/3 cup packed brown sugar and set aside.

    GINGERBREAD: Combine remaining 1/2 cup butter, molasses, sugar, remaining 1/3 cup packed brown sugar and egg in a mixing bowl. Mix well. Combine remaining dry ingredients and add to batter, alternating with tea; mix well. Pour over apples. Bake for 45 to 50 minutes or until a toothpick inserted near center comes out clean. Cool for 3 to 5 minutes. Run a knife around the sides of the pan and invert on serving plate. Serve warm. Serves 9
